Explore the third lecture on Single Spin Asymmetries and Transverse Momentum Dependent Parton Distribution Functions (TMDs) delivered by Andrea Signori. Delve into advanced concepts in hadron structure and spin physics relevant to the Electron-Ion Collider (EIC) research. Gain insights into the distribution of quarks and gluons inside nucleons, the role of orbital angular momentum, and the investigation of spin-dependent phenomena. Part of the International School and Workshop on Probing Hadron Structure at the EIC, this lecture contributes to preparing researchers for the groundbreaking experiments planned at Brookhaven National Laboratory's future EIC facility.
